Position Summary:ThePurchasing Agentsources procures and manages the acquisition of goods and services for an organization focusing on balancing cost quality and timely delivery by evaluating suppliers negotiating contracts analyzing prices and maintaining strong vendor relationships while also handling purchase orders tracking shipments and ensuring compliance. Key duties involve researching products negotiating terms managing inventory and ensuring smooth supply chain operations to support company needs position will also manage company credit cards and approve monthly credit card expense reports.
This is a non-supervisory position.
Essential Job Functions:
Sourcing & Evaluation: Researching and identifying potential suppliers evaluating their products pricing quality and reliability.Negotiation: Analyzing price proposals negotiating contracts and securing the best possible deals for goods and services.Procurement: Preparing and issuing purchase orders confirming deliveries and managing vendor interactions.Cost & Quality Control: Conducting cost analyses reviewing financial reports and ensuring purchased items meet quality standards.Relationship Management: Building and maintaining long-term positive relationships with suppliers and vendors.Record Keeping: Maintaining accurate purchasing records tracking shipments and preparing reports.Market Awareness: Staying informed about industry trends new products and market be able to work in a diverse setting with diverse populations including persons living with HIV the LGBTQ community persons of various ethnic backgrounds disenfranchised communities.
